The Core Mechanics of the Chicken Road Game

At its heart, the gameplay of a chicken road game is remarkably straightforward. Players assume control of a chicken, whose primary objective is to cross a road filled with oncoming traffic. This is achieved by carefully timing movements to avoid collisions with cars, trucks, and other vehicles. The game typically incorporates a scoring system, often based on the distance traveled or the number of successful crossings. Obstacles aren’t limited to vehicles; some versions introduce additional hurdles, like moving platforms or environmental hazards, increasing the challenge. Successful navigation earns points, and collecting items – frequently coins or power-ups – further boosts the score. The combination of simple controls and escalating difficulty creates a compelling loop that’s quick to learn but requires growing skill to conquer.

The game is often played on mobile devices, utilizing touch controls for movement. Swiping or tapping on the screen directs the chicken, and the responsiveness of these controls is crucial for a positive gaming experience. Visual design typically leans toward bright, cartoonish graphics, contributing to the game’s lighthearted and casual appeal. Many iterations also include customizable chickens, adding a layer of personalization. The simplicity of the concept is deceptively engaging, proving that addictive gameplay doesn’t always require complex mechanics or intricate storylines.

Strategies for Mastering the Chicken Road

While the chicken road game appears simple, mastering it requires developing strategic awareness. A proactive approach is more effective than simply reacting to oncoming traffic. Players should study the patterns of vehicle movement, learning to predict when gaps will appear. Focusing on the spaces between cars, rather than the cars themselves, allows for more efficient route planning. Collecting coins and power-ups isn’t just about boosting the score; some power-ups might provide temporary invincibility or slow down traffic, offering crucial advantages. Persistence is also key – frequent play builds muscle memory and refines timing. Don’t be discouraged by early failures; each attempt provides valuable learning experience.

Advanced players often employ “risk assessment” – weighing the potential reward of a daring move against the risk of a collision. Sometimes, a well-timed dash through seemingly impossible traffic is the quickest way to progress. Learning to control the chicken’s speed is also vital. Short, controlled bursts are often more effective than long, sustained runs. It’s also beneficial to observe how different vehicle types behave. Trucks, for instance, have longer braking distances than cars. Focusing on these nuances takes time, but dramatically improves one’s chances of success.

The Psychology of Addictive Gameplay

The enduring popularity of the chicken road game stems from its exploitation of core psychological principles. The game provides a constant stream of immediate feedback – success or failure is instantly apparent with each crossing. This instant gratification triggers the release of dopamine in the brain, creating a rewarding cycle. The escalating difficulty curve keeps players engaged, introducing new challenges as skills improve, preventing boredom. The simple, clear goal – crossing the road – is easily understood, making the game accessible to a wide audience. The sensation of “near misses” – narrowly avoiding collisions – also contributes to the addictive quality, creating a thrilling sense of excitement.

Furthermore, the “high score” mechanic taps into our innate competitive drive. Players strive to beat their previous records or surpass the scores of friends, fostering sustained engagement. Social sharing features, where players can compare scores online, amplify this effect. The randomness of the traffic pattern adds an element of unpredictability, meaning players can’t simply memorize sequences; they must react and adapt, requiring constant mental engagement. This confluence of psychological factors makes the chicken road game a remarkably compelling and addictive experience, despite its simplicity.

The Evolution of the Chicken Road Genre

While the original concept remains largely consistent, the chicken road genre has evolved over time, incorporating new features and variations. Some versions introduce multiple chickens, each with unique abilities or characteristics. Others implement power-ups that dramatically alter gameplay, such as speed boosts, temporary invincibility, or the ability to freeze traffic. Environment variations are another common addition, with roads changing in appearance and introducing new obstacles. Some games have even integrated elements of “endless runner” gameplay, where the road continues indefinitely, and the player aims to travel the furthest distance possible. These variations keep the genre fresh and prevent it from becoming stale.

Beyond cosmetic changes, more significant developments have focused on monetization strategies. Free-to-play versions often incorporate in-app purchases, allowing players to buy coins, power-ups, or cosmetic items. This has sometimes led to criticisms regarding “pay-to-win” mechanics, where players who spend money gain an unfair advantage. However, many developers strive to balance monetization with fair gameplay, offering optional purchases that enhance the experience without being essential for success. The genre continues to adapt, exploring new ways to engage players and maintain its enduring appeal
